5. The Miz - 2010
As a smarmy, gloating, pretty much insufferable heel, the Miz’s gimmick was tailor-made for a stint with the Money in the Bank briefcase.
His run lasted the better part of four months and saw multiple cash-in attempts on then-champion Sheamus, but each time he’d find his plans foiled. Miz was also United States champion at the time and it was during this period that he and Daniel Bryan had their memorable rivalry, which ultimately saw Miz lose the belt in a quality meeting at Night of Champions.
Still, Miz’s consolation prize eventually came when he cashed in on the relatively small-scale stage of Monday Night Raw after Randy Orton had just defended his WWE title against Wade Barrett. Not only did it back up all of his bravado and braggadocio, but it also saw him go on to headline the following year’s WrestleMania.
One of the main purposes of a Money in the Bank run is to elevate a mid-carder to the main event scene, and that’s exactly what was achieved during Miz’s stint.
